Nucrel® 0902HC is an ethylene-methacrylic acid copolymer resin, made nominally from 9 wt% methacrylic acid. The resin is available for use in conventional blown and cast film extrusion and coextrusion equipment designed to process polyethylene resins. |

Physical | Nominal Value | Unit | Test Method |
---|---|---|---|
Specific Gravity | 0.930 | g/cm³ | ASTM D792, ISO 1183 |
Melt Mass-Flow Rate (MFR) (190°C/2.16 kg) | 1.5 | g/10 min | ASTM D1238, ISO 1133 |
Methacrylic Acid Content | 9.0 | wt% |
Thermal | Nominal Value | Unit | Test Method |
---|---|---|---|
Freezing Point | |||
-- | 78 | °C | ISO 3146 |
-- | 78 | °C | ASTM D3418 |
Vicat Softening Temperature | 81.0 | °C | ASTM D1525, ISO 306 |
Peak Melting Temperature | 103 | °C | ASTM D3418, ISO 3146 |
Extrusion | Nominal Value | Unit | |
---|---|---|---|
Cylinder Zone 1 Temp. | 135 | °C | |
Cylinder Zone 2 Temp. | 160 | °C | |
Cylinder Zone 3 Temp. | 185 | °C | |
Cylinder Zone 4 Temp. | 185 | °C | |
Cylinder Zone 5 Temp. | 185 | °C | |
Adapter Temperature | 185 | °C | |
Melt Temperature | < 310 | °C | |
Die Temperature | 185 | °C |
Extrusion instructions |
---|
Processing conditions shown are for blown film. |
